Water/Wastewater EIT/Designer (Hydraulic Modeling)
HDR is a company dedicated to creating a welcoming environment for its employees while focusing on impactful work in water management. They are seeking a Water/Wastewater Engineer-in-Training (EIT) / Designer to support utility planning and hydraulic modeling projects, ensuring sustainable water management for communities in North and South Carolina.
ArchitectureConsulting
Responsibilities
Develop and calibrate water and wastewater hydraulic models
Perform GIS data analysis, alternatives analysis, preliminary engineering, cost analysis, and capital project development
Client interaction in project meetings and presentations
Report writing and developing proposal scopes with level of effort estimates
Task-level responsibility for project teams, mentoring and quality assurance/quality control activities for hydraulic modeling and master planning projects
